Scope overview
The Partnership Fund for a Resilient Ukraine Phase 2 (Project) is a multi-year, multi-donor funded programme managed by the UK's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Office (FCDO). The aim of PFRU-2 is to strengthen the resilience of the Ukrainian government, economy, media, and the Ukrainian civil society by delivering essential resilience project support to the relevant partners.
In alignment, PFRU-2 is identifying vendors who will help with the Construction services for the Ongoing repairs Surgical Department of the Snihurivka City Hospital at the following address: Snihurivka, Bashtanskyi District, Mykolaiv Region, 200 Rokiv Snihurivky Street 1. The services to be procured under this ITT are required for the Project's implementation are further explained under Volume 3 Terms of Reference.
Tenderers are responsible for ensuring that their offers are received by Chemonics UK in accordance with the instructions, terms, and conditions described in this ITT.
